Programs that offer residential beds for clients offer these beds so mothers can be in a protected place with their children while they're in the rehab that will restore their lives and keep their children with them. The flipside for these children would be much worse , so it can ease the mind of the mother as well as the kid, to have a protected place to stay and be with each other. Residential beds are accessible for women who are pregnant or postpartum and for children until the age of 5 or 6.
The length of stay in these residential facilities can be different, and so can treatment offerings. For pregnant and postpartum women, beds are accessible but so are medical services specific to these clients. If a woman is pregnant, or perhaps breast feeding and postpartum, these factors are taken under advisement during and after detoxification to make sure the child is safe. For Instance, someone who is opiate addicted or who is getting methadone assisted treatment would be treated in a way that would keep the baby safe. Aside from the residential beds offered, many programs in La Prairie offer other offerings to help mothers and fathers get through rehab more easily such as daycare.
